Description: Unidentified nephew, Georgia, writing to Colonel and Mrs. Eberhard P. Deutsch, New Orleans. Letter was forwarded from the St. Moritz Hotel in New York. Nephew writes to "Aunt Rhea and Uncle Eb" that he received their message and is heeding their advice; alludes to an incident at lunch but will explain in detail at some later time; a picture of him will appear in the Atlanta Exposition; he is driving a pick-up truck prone to breaking down; he may go to Atlanta soon; he hopes to be in Milledgeville soon; he believes he will be busier over the weekend than he has been; sends his love. Letter is inside original envelope.
